Smyrna sits on Cobb County clay, which creates real challenges for traditional pool landscaping. That heavy clay drains poorly, meaning water pools around your deck area instead of flowing away—exactly what you don't want near a pool. Artificial turf solves this from day one because we install it over a proper drainage system that actually moves water where it needs to go. Shade patterns matter here too. Properties in Vinings tend to have mature tree coverage, which is beautiful but can create wet spots that never fully dry if you rely on natural grass. Our pool turf systems are designed to handle partial shade without becoming slippery or developing algae growth. Clay soil is actually why artificial turf works so well here. We install a permeable base layer that allows water to drain through instead of pooling on the surface like it does with natural grass. Your pool area stays dry and safe within minutes, which is huge for Smyrna's wet conditions.
Absolutely. Partial shade is common in Vinings, and artificial turf doesn't need sunlight to stay green and healthy. It won't develop the wet, algae-prone spots that plague natural grass in shady pool areas. Full sun areas are easier, but shade isn't a barrier.
Most residential pool projects take 3–5 days depending on yard size and prep work needed. If you have drainage challenges from Cobb County clay, we might spend an extra day on the base layer. We'll give you an exact timeline after our initial site visit.
